The tragic murder of Mary Phagan, a young girl whose death in 1913 ignited a sensational trial and led to one of the most notorious lynchings in American history. Join us as we unravel the events surrounding her murder, the wrongful conviction of Leo Frank, and the ensuing societal implications that resonate to this day.
